Where can an extension cord be used and how long?

Final answer:

Extension cords can be used indefinitely if not damaged and used within their rating, but cheaper or longer cords can result in a voltage drop and power loss. This affects the power output and efficiency of connected appliances due to increased resistance and heat dissipation.

Step-by-step explanation:

Extension cords are used to provide power to an appliance or device that is located at a distance from a power outlet. When using an extension cord, it's important to ensure it is rated for the power requirements of the appliance and for the environment in which it will be used. The length of time an extension cord can be used is indefinite so long as it is not physically damaged and it remains within its operational ratings. However, the power output of an appliance can be affected by the use of an inadequately rated extension cord.

An example of the potential issue is when a long, inexpensive extension cord is connected to a high-power appliance like a refrigerator. The refrigerator might not run as it should because the cord might have higher electrical resistance due to its length and the thinner wire used. This results in a voltage drop along the extension cord, which reduces the voltage and thus the power supplied to the refrigerator. For example, an extension cord with a resistance of 0.0600 ohms through which 5.00 A is flowing would have a voltage drop of 0.300 V (calculated by Ohm's law, V = I * R). In contrast, a cheaper cord with a higher resistance of 0.300 ohms would result in a voltage drop of 1.50 V.

A more technical explanation involves calculating the power dissipated in the extension cords. Using the formula P = I2R, where P is power, I is current, and R is resistance, we can assess the power lost in the cord as heat. A good quality extension cord would dissipate less power than a cheaper cord with higher resistance, leading to less energy waste and a smaller reduction in voltage reaching the appliance.
